      <description>&lt;P&gt;if you're trying to FTP files -to- your own PC from a remote loaction you'll need a few extra steps: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;1: set port forwarding on the router to forward port 21 (standard ftp) to the local IP of the pc on your network&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;2: make sure the firewall on the local pc will accept FTP traffic&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;3: install an FTP server on the local pc&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;4: create a user account using the FTP server software.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;then&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;5: using a remote computer connect to your static IP using the credentials created in step 4.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;^ all thats a bit simplified as it all depends on your OS version etc etc. but hopefully a starting point &lt;span class="lia-unicode-emoji" title=":slightly_smiling_face:"&gt;🙂&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;cheers, Phil.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
